Shipping Destination Vietnam, Cambodia
Of late Vietnam and Cambodia have become the destinations of several leading shipping lines. Singapore-based Neptune Orient Lines (NOL) has received approval from Vietnam's Ministry of Planning and Investment to establish a wholly-owned company to provide container transportation and logistics services in that country, making a first for a Singapore-based company. The new APL-NOL (Vietnam) replaces the existing joint venture. NOL's subsidiaries APL and APL Logistics have been providing container transportation and supply chain management services in Vietnam in association with a local shipping and logistics company, Vietfracht, since 1991. Orient Overseas Container Line too has opened two offices in Vietnam, in the capital city of Hanoi and the northern port city of Haiphong. Meanwhile, Mitsui OSK Lines opened a new subsidiary, MOL (Cambodia), in Cambodia to handle liner business and ocean consolidation business and will take over the current functions of Global SKL Shipping, MOL's sole agent in the country.
